Finding and Saving Posts

The first step to utilizing the saved posts feature is knowing how to find and save content that resonates with you. As you scroll through your feed or the Explore page, keep an eye out for posts that capture your interest. To save, simply tap the bookmark icon located below the post. This action marks the post for future reference, ensuring you can revisit it any time you want. Think of it as adding something to your digital scrapbook!

[Insert image placeholder showing someone tapping the bookmark icon]

Accessing and Reviewing Saved Posts

To access your saved posts, navigate to your profile, tap on the three horizontal lines (the menu), and select “Saved.” Here, you’ll find all the posts you’ve saved, neatly stored. Utilizing Instagram’s Collections Feature

Instagram allows you to organize saved posts into collections within the app. Here’s how you can maximize this feature:

  • Create New Collections: To make a new collection, go to your saved posts and tap the plus sign (+) to create a new collection. You can name it something memorable.
  • Adding Content: When you save a post, you have the option to add it to an existing collection or create a new one—this keeps the process simple and efficient.
  • Edit Collections: You can edit collection names and sort posts within each collection anytime you want, allowing for flexible organization as your interests evolve.

Utilizing Instagram's built-in features provides an intuitive way to keep your collections up-to-date and relevant.
